Program 1 will provide you with an overview of what to expect during labour, birth and your hospital stay. It will also provide you with some tips for the aftercare of your baby.

It is recommended this program be completed between 28 and 32 weeks gestation. This session is done during Saturday either between 9:30am-11:30am or 12:30pm -2:30pm. Please note, there will be a maximum of 20 people per class (10 couples).


Program 1 includes:

  • Active labour and birth
  • Pain relief options
  • Feeding options
  • Routine screening tests performed while in hospital
  • The role of the support person
  • Caesarean birth
  • Basic baby needs

This one hour program specifically covers topics that will support successful breastfeeding.

It is recommended expectant mothers attend this program between 36 and 38 weeks gestation.

This program will address:

  • Positioning
  • Attachment
  • Parental adjustment

Please note that only our expectant mothers are invited to attend this session.

Join other “Dads to be” to discuss early parenting, the role of fathers and what to expect with your newborn baby. This is a two hour session to be undertaken when your partner is around 32 to 37 weeks gestation.

Tops include:

  • Benefits of being an involved father
  • Child development
  • Breastfeeding information
  • Settling techniques
  • Infant behaviors
  • Sings of illness

First time fathers may feel nervous but a little planning goes a long way into preparing you for this amazing role. There is a $30.00 fee per Dad, fees are payable on the day. Please present to the reception desk located at the hospital main entrance.
